4-AN ACT concerning civil law.
5-Be it enacted by the People of the State of Illinois,
6-represented in the General Assembly:
7-Section 2. The Code of Civil Procedure is amended by
8-adding Section 2-101.5 as follows:
9-(735 ILCS 5/2-101.5 new)
10-Sec. 2-101.5. Venue in actions asserting constitutional
11-claims against the State.
12-(a) Notwithstanding any other provisions of this Code, if
13-an action is brought against the State or any of its officers,
14-employees, or agents acting in an official capacity on or
15-after the effective date of this amendatory Act of the 103rd
16-General Assembly seeking declaratory or injunctive relief
17-against any State statute, rule, or executive order based on
18-an alleged violation of the Constitution of the State of
19-Illinois or the Constitution of the United States, venue in
20-that action is proper only in the County of Sangamon and the
21-County of Cook.
22-(b) The doctrine of forum non conveniens does not apply to
23-actions subject to this Section.
24-(c) As used in this Section, "State" has the meaning given
25-to that term in Section 1 of the State Employee
26-Indemnification Act.

33-(d) The provisions of this Section do not apply to claims
34-arising out of collective bargaining disputes between the
35-State of Illinois and the representatives of its employees.
36-Section 99. Effective date. This Act takes effect upon
37-becoming law.
